Ysl b10 b20 cheap
Ysl b10 b20 cheap
Ysl b10 b20 cheap
Ysl b10 b20 cheap
Ysl b10 b20 cheap
Ysl b10 b20 cheap

Ysl b10 b20 cheap

Ysl b10 b20 cheap, Luniqe Store on X YSL Le Cushion Ready B10 B20 B30 B40 B50 B60 limited stock 790rb https t W1tLdiqZQS X cheap

$47.00

SKU: 7472339

Colour
  • YSL Ltd.Edition Beauty Touche Eclat Glow Pact Cushion High Cover Mesh Foundation B10 B20 All Day Flawless Coverage
  • YSL Encre De Peau All Hours Foundation SPF20 B10 B20 BD20 BD35 B40 Sklep z odlewkami oryginalnych perfum
  • YSL cushion SALE Available in shade B10 B15 B20 B25 B30 B35 20 Matte finish with buildable and HIGH COVERAGE cushion
  • YSL Cushion B10 Review
Out of stock
Personalised:
: ( x )
Personalisation:
Edit
Remove Personalisation
Frasers Plus

Buy now.

Pay later.

Earn rewards

Representative APR: 29.9% (variable)

Credit subject to status. Terms apply.

Missed payments may affect your credit score

FrasersPlus